[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] This is the only fleece sweater/jacket that tried in store in a different print and purchased online that actually fit properly. The arms are still a bit long but nothing disproportionate like the rest of the sweaters. Love the boxy crop style. True to size and bought XL. For reference, I’m 5’5”, 185lbs, usually wear L-XL. This is a really cool sweater….EXCEPT…for the location of the print. The prints are fun and colors are cute but I took one star out because the prints are random and not placed as shown on pictures online. Bought the green/blue with the mountain landscape and the peak is on the bottom and the rest on my shoulders, pretty stupid because the magic of this style is actually the prints. Because of it, it does not look like the pictures but instead more like a random camo print. Debating if keeping or not, or even reordering to see if I receive one with a better print placement. Very annoying though. Otherwise a very cute sweater.

This jacket is so soft. Normally I don’t care for Sherpa type fabric, but this is actually quite soft and doesn’t feel like it’s catching on my skin like some Sherpa does. I like horses and it’s very hard to find designs that feature them but look mature and don’t scream “crazy horse girl.” So that was definitely a bonus haha. I sized up a little bit so that if I wanted to layer something under it the arms wouldn’t feel too tight. I’m very glad I did and it didn’t make the sleeves too long, a problem I have even when I do get my normal size. Overall I really like this jacket and can see myself wearing it for many years to come.
